MBP 88.0 Halaven (eribulin mesylate)
Halaven (eribulin) is a nontaxane microtubule dynamics inhibitor that inhibits the growth phase of microtubules without affecting the shortening phase, and sequesters tubulin into nonproductive aggregates. Eribulin exerts its effects via a tubulin-based antimitotic mechanism leading to G2/M cell-cycle block, disruption of mitotic spindles, and, ultimately, apoptotic cell death after prolonged mitotic blockage

MBP 179.0 Hemlibra (emicizumab-kxwh)
Hemlibra (emicizumab-kxwh) is a humanized monoclonal modified immunoglobulin G4 (IgG4) antibody with a bispecific factor IXa- and factor X-directed antibody, bridges activated factor IX and factor X to restore the function of missing activated factor VIII that is needed for effective hemostasis. Emicizumab-kxwh has no structural relationship or sequence homology to FVIII and, therefore, does not induce or enhance the development of direct inhibitors to FVIII.
